         <description><![CDATA[<div>One major issue in the book is bullying when the students send this list around school. The list works positively for the ones named the prettiest but the ones named ugly&nbsp; it hurts. Being called the ugliest girl in your class publicly can be a major turning point for some high school girls. One example of bullying is when girls scream down the hallway at Danielle, "Dan the man."(Vivian 139). This continues to happen to different girls throughout the book causing a major bullying problem.<br><a href="http://cdn1.medicalnewstoday.com/content/images/articles/293/293134/girl-being-bullied-by-a-group-of-girls.jpg">http://cdn1.medicalnewstoday.com/content/images/articles/293/293134/girl-being-bullied-by-a-group-of-girls.jpg</a></div>]]></description>

         <description><![CDATA[<div>One theme in the book is popularity. A character, Candace, proves this when she says, "I know what shes looking at- a column of names stretching down a page. A list of girls dying to ride with her in the homecoming parade."(Vivian 140). Another theme in the book is self worth. Sarah doesn't think she is worth very much to her family or other girls. she feels out of place everywhere she goes.<br><a href="http://schoollyd.com/p/2016/11/notebook-to-write-in-cofklb4m.jpg">http://schoollyd.com/p/2016/11/notebook-to-write-in-cofklb4m.jpg</a></div>]]></description>
